At-risk of poverty rate of unemployed persons
Hungary, 2025
In 2025, Hungary's at-risk of poverty rate of unemployed persons decreased by 19.1% compared to 2024, reaching 45.0.
Hungary accounts for 91.3% of the EU-27 total of 49.3.
Hungary ranks 14th out of 26 EU member states with reported data — in the bottom half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has fallen by 19.1% (from 55.6 in 2020).
